Not sure what the raceweight is now, still have to pull the ABS system, EVAP, door bars, heat shields, and I havent even gotten the cut off wheel out yet. Trying for 2800 pounds when its all said and done.

Definatly will post when I hit the track, couple things I want done before I go, will need a cage built and installed, weld prostars-skinnies and drag radials, do the 847 cam, and install a 150 shot of nitrous. Also would like to throw a set of 3.73s or 4.10s in to hold me over till i can do a 9 inch if i can find a rear end cheap or the gears.
